Office Automation Engineer

Job Summary

Pegatron Technologies LLC is seeking a highly skilled and dependable Office Automation Engineer to join our Information Technologies team. This role is responsible for ensuring the smooth operation and maintenance of office automation systems, server infrastructure, and network environments. The ideal candidate will possess strong technical expertise, problem-solving skills, and the ability to support both hardware and software systems critically to business oper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Maintain and troubleshoot Office Automation (OA) systems to ensure optimal performance.
  • Oversee server room operations, including hardware maintenance, environmental controls, and security compliance.
  • Perform network system maintenance, including configuration, monitoring, and performance optimization.
  • Assist new employees with OA setup and resolve equipment-related issues promptly.
  • Manage IT equipment maintenance, including servers, networking devices, and server room facilities.
  • Conduct network troubleshooting, including ISP circuit issues and cybersecurity incident response.
  • Collaborate with internal teams and external vendors to ensure reliable IT infrastructure and security standards.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in computer science, or Information Technology, or a related field.
  • Language proficiency: English, Chinese (preferred)
  • 3 years of experience in OA system maintenance
  • 3 years of experience in network maintenance
  • 3 years of experience in server maintenance
  • 3 years of experience in information security management

Skills & Competencies

  • Proficiency in Office Automation systems and related software tools
  • Strong understanding of network protocols (T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P) and troubleshooting techniques
  • Experience with server administration (Windows/Linux), virtualization, and storage solutions
  • Knowledge of cybersecurity principles and best practices
  • Familiarity with ISP circuit management and network performance monitoring tools
  • Excellent problem-solving, analytical, and organizational skills
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ment

Preferred Certifications

  •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) or equivalent networking certification.
  • CompTIA Security+ or other cybersecurity-related certifications.
  • Microsoft Certified: Windows Server or Azure Administrator Associate.
  • ITIL Foundation Certification for IT Service Management.
VMware Certified Professional (VCP) for virtualization
